Output 321aeb778d39fd6754d001c5a27ad404f141e882f05d9a8aaddf71573eae3624:0

value
5079815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ab93706238ccac8c7bb3fde64758b6e71690905 OP_EQUAL
address
3MdX7KeHbSzKMay7wifszNGohK3e3Evk1P
transaction
321aeb778d39fd6754d001c5a27ad404f141e882f05d9a8aaddf71573eae3624
spent
true